Thu 18th May 2023 - Charlevoix
Parc national des Grands-Jardins / ZEC des Martres Mont du Gros Bras
5.7 Sinus - with Pier-Alexandre, Kexin Huang
1 5.7 Trad
2 5.7 Second
3 5.7 Trad
4 Second
5 5.7 Second
6 5.7 Trad
Trad 200m
Route is severely under apreciated. Once the start is located, The rest of the routefinding is relatively easy (for the area). We climbed it in 5 fifth-class pitches and one 4th class (6 total). The first half of the climb is very clean. The second half could use a small amount of love but is still clean relative to local standards.

The climb was perfectly dry up to the ramp with two or three soaked moves. Our last pitch (exiting the ramp) was soaking wet (dry lesser quality options seemed available). The grade is consistent with local old school grades.

Wed 7th Sep 2022 - Charlevoix
Palissades de Charlevoix Les Grandes Dalles
5.7 5.7 R Granuleuse Trad 350m Classic
Simul in one pitch with a few 4-5m belays for cruxes. This climb is great. Much much better than the 'sport 400'. 1h55min ground to top. 51min rappel.

Gear spoiler: we brought single from #0 to #3, doubles from 0.4 to #2, triples from 0.5 to #1 with a full set of stoppers and tricams (2 black, two pink and one red). A standard double rack would be fine if climbing normally. I did place the 0.1 and 0.2 in the first pitch. Stoppers would probably work provided some gardening. #4 or #5 might be usefull if planning on doing the p5 dirty off-width variant.

 
Voie normale Sport 400m
We started way off route on a friction slab with few protections. PA lead a ~200m simul-block to a tree belay. Not recommended. The pitch had few protections with friction and balance moves up to 5.9 over ~10m runouts. We then proceeded to climb 3 70m pitches to the top, swapping leads. We believe to have been back on route for those pitches. 1h51min for the simul-block, and 1h52min for the remaining three pitches. ~1h for the rappel.

Total time car to car for the three climbs: ~12h30min

 
Sun 21st Aug 2022 - Charlevoix
Palissades de Charlevoix Serpentin
5.9 Serpentin
1 5.9 90m
2 5.6
3 5.8 lead by Noah Boudreau-Richard
4 5.9 lead by Noah Boudreau-Richard
Sport 90m
Very nice climb. Should get more traffic. The poison ivy at the base had us bushwhack the ramp left of the climb until we met with the first bolt. Raph linked the two first pitches using a few long draws to manage drag. He built a tree anchor at the beginning of the "Garden" to avoid horrendous drag. I did a 5m short-rope pitch to move the anchor over to the bolts. Then I linked the last two pitches into an enjoyable 40m pitch. We rappelled into "Microgravité" for an extra pitch.

 
5.10a Microgravité Sport 35m, 17
Bonus pitch! Great climb. Good movement. Many many bolts with mostly secure climbing.
